Understanding Forex Cards
A Forex card is a prepaid card designed specifically for international travelers. It offers numerous advantages, including the ability to convert multiple currencies simultaneously, often with competitive exchange rates compared to traditional methods. By utilizing a Forex card, you can avoid the hassle of carrying cash and safeguard yourself against currency fluctuations.
Methods for Checking Your Forex Card Balance
There are several convenient methods to check your Forex card balance, allowing you to stay informed about your financial situation:
1. Online Banking
Many Forex card providers offer online banking platforms. By registering for an account, you can access your card details, including your balance and transaction history. This method provides comprehensive information and the ease of managing your finances from anywhere with an internet connection.

2. Mobile App
If your Forex card provider has a dedicated mobile application, you can download it to your smartphone. These apps often offer a user-friendly interface and the ability to check your balance, view statements, and initiate transactions from the palm of your hand.
3. Customer Service Hotline
For direct assistance, you can contact the customer service hotline of your Forex card provider. A representative will guide you through the process of checking your balance and provide any necessary support.
4. SMS Banking
Some Forex card providers offer SMS banking services. By sending a pre-defined message to a specific number, you can receive a text message with your balance information. This option is particularly helpful when you don’t have access to the internet or while traveling in remote areas with limited connectivity.
5. ATM Withdrawal
If you have access to an ATM, you can insert your Forex card and select the “Balance Inquiry” option. This method is convenient, especially when you need cash, as it provides both your balance and the option to withdraw funds.
Tips for Monitoring Your Forex Card Balance Regularly
To ensure responsible financial management, it’s recommended to check your Forex card balance regularly, especially while traveling abroad. Here are some practical tips to help you do just that:
- Set up automatic balance alerts: Many Forex card providers allow you to set up email or SMS alerts that notify you when your balance falls below a certain threshold.
- Keep a record of your expenses: Jotting down your purchases and withdrawals in a notebook or spreadsheet can help you track your spending and identify any discrepancies.
- Use a budgeting app: There are numerous budgeting apps available that can help you track your Forex card transactions and stay within your financial limits.
- Avoid unnecessary transactions: Be mindful of the transaction fees associated with using your Forex card and avoid making excessive or unnecessary withdrawals.
